自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 资源 (1)
  • 问答 (1)
  • 收藏
  • 关注

原创 MxNet获取DataLoader里的数据

获取DataLoader中的数据DataLoader返回的是一个迭代器,其中每次迭代返回一个数组(数组中的元素是迭代器中返回的内容NdArray)。例如train, test = d2l.load_data_fashion_mnist(batch_size=1)#train是一个DataLoder,含有features,labels(他们都是NDArray类型的)for features, labels in train: print(features, labels) break;

2020-10-31 16:03:00 1409

原创 父类中可以调用子类函数

父类中调用子类函数python中的父子类分界不是那么明确,因为在子类构造函数中调用父类构造函数时可以传递子类的self,这样父类中就知道子类函数的存在了。但是在Java中并不可以因为Java是一种强制类型的语言,this并不是一个数据实例所以实现不了父类调用子类中函数的情况。例如:class A: def __init__(self): a = 0; def port(self): self.out();class B(A): def __i

2020-10-31 15:59:26 1126

原创 jupyter修改默认浏览器与自动补全

jupyter修改默认浏览器与自动补全修改默认浏览器找到jupter_notebook_config.py(在c:\users\ASUS-PC\.jupyer中)找到# c.NotebookApp.browser = ‘’’’改为:import webbrowserwebbrowser.register('chrome', None, webbrowser.GenericBrowser(u'C:\\Program Files (x86)\\Google\\Chrome\\Applic

2020-10-27 19:47:04 260

原创 python环境配置

python环境配置创建python环境安装pipconda create -n env_name python=python_visionenv_name为你的环境名,python_vision是你的python版本。查看环境空间:conda info --envs激活环境空间:conda activate env_name安装pip(只用安装一次):使用python安装:先下载pip:https://pypi.python.org/pypi/pip#downloads解压到

2020-10-27 08:53:01 246 1

原创 流继承图

流继承图

2020-10-26 20:36:52 97

原创 JavaEE基础(六)Ajax

文章目录Java基础(六)AjaxAjax简介Ajax的JS实现方式Ajax的jQuery实现方式第一种方式(既可以是get、也可以是post)第二种方式:.get()、.get()、.get()、.post()(确定了是get还是post)Ajax处理JSON数据JSONJSON在语言中的表示处理(JSON数据是服务端给客户端传的数据)Java基础(六)AjaxAjax简介在之前使用form进行提交,经过servlet返回数据后才会刷新。这会使整个页面刷新,这在某些方面会很不好,所以使用Ajax进行

2020-10-22 17:21:27 546

原创 两次请求与三次握手

两次请求与三次握手在使用监听器时。第一次访问服务器时,显示request创建销毁了三次,session创建销毁了三次,这是由于网络传输是基与Http协议的,而Http协议在在第一次访问服务器时进行的是三次握手。所以显示三次。在于服务器建立链接后,关闭浏览器,重新打开页面会产生两次request的创建与销毁,一次session的产生,这是由于第一次产生的是options请求,第二次才是正常的请求。在页面打开时刷新页面会产生一次request的创建与删除,这是正常的request访问服务器产生的。.

2020-10-19 21:21:58 338

原创 JavaEE基础(五)过滤器监听器

文章目录Java基础(五)过滤器、监听器过滤器过滤器的使用过滤器链监听器配置监听器监听对象的创建与销毁request监听器(ServerRequestListener)session监听器(HttpSessionListener)application监听器(ServletContextListener)监听三个监听对象中属性的变更(add、remove、replace)ServletRequestAttributeListenerHttpSessionAttributeListenerServletCon

2020-10-17 12:35:59 319 1

原创 JavaEE基础(二)JDBC存取数据

文章目录JDBC(Java DataBase Connectivity)初始化驱动连接数据库CUDR增删改查使用自动关闭的rs、pstmt、connectionJDBC处理大文本及二进制类型数据JDBC(Java DataBase Connectivity)​ 作用:是Java与数据库之间的桥梁。可为多种关系型DBMS提供统一的访问方式。JDBC简单架构:JDBC基本流程:与数据库建立连接。使用sql进行CUDR(增删改查)。返回处理结果。初始化驱动try {

2020-10-16 13:28:09 569

原创 JavaEE基础(四)EL与JSTL

文章目录JavaEE基础(四)EL与JSTLEL表达式EL运算符点运算符中括号运算符关系、逻辑运算符empty运算符EL表达式中的三类隐式对象作用域访问对象(用于服务器内部元素的获取)参数访问对象(用于form表单中元素的获取)JSP隐式对象(用于获取JSP中隐式对象)JSTL表达式通用标签库(进行增删改查)增、改查删条件标签库(进行条件判断)单重选择多重选择迭代标签库(循环)普通迭代类java加强for循环迭代类java加强for循环迭代JavaEE基础(四)EL与JSTLEL表达式EL用来在jsp

2020-10-15 16:02:05 443

原创 JavaEE基础(一)JSP

文章目录JSP基础JSP简介JSP显示过程Tomcat服务器JSP生命周期JSP页面元素九大内置对象request对象request对象方法:request内容乱码问题response对象及方法重定向与请求转发的区别session对象cookie对象session对象application对象四大范围对象JSP基础JSP简介JSP也是一种可以显示的页面类型,与HTML相似。JSP与HTML的区别就是:JSP是动态页面HTML是静态页面什么是动态静态?静态动态的区别就是是否随着时间、地点、用

2020-10-13 20:33:40 1072

原创 在请求目标中找到无效字符

在请求目标中找到无效字符错误样例:错误原因:server解析不了一些特殊字符。解决方法:在tomcat->config->server.xml中将这部分代码加上一部分字符解析代码如:<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" redirectPort="8443" URIEncoding="UTF-8"

2020-10-13 20:26:38 3347

原创 rs不允许关闭后使用

rs在关闭后不能使用错误原因:提前关闭了connection导致rs也被迫关闭,尽管rs通过函数返回出去但是却关了,所以rs容器中没内容了。错误样例:错误代码:解决方法:将所有需要关闭的对象都提到成员中,最后一起关闭。使用Result类的,toResult(ResultSet)...

2020-10-06 18:48:04 248

原创 存储文本时报错

存储文本时报错错误1错误:java.sql.SQLException: Incorrect string value: ‘\xD4\xDA\xB8\xF7\xB8\xF6’ for column ‘context’ at row 1原因:文本存储格式错误,文本的默认格式是ANSI。解决办法:另存文本使格式更改为utf-8。错误2错误:java.sql.SQLException: Unknown character set index for field ‘255’ received from s

2020-10-06 11:06:12 779

原创 数据库连接池

数据库连接池​ 数据库连接池时用来存放非正在使用的连接(connection)用的。在java中使用语句:Connection connection = DriverManager.getConnection(url, name, password);建立连接。连接创建的过程:​ 当connection close后并不会释放connection的内存,connection仍存在与内存中只不过不再工作了。statement、resultset存在于connectio

2020-10-06 10:28:36 123 1

原创 servlet的周期

servlet的生命周期​ 在用户访问服务端时会在servlet容器中创建一个用户的servlet,web服务器会对用户的请求进行捕获并传递给servlet容器容器产生相应的servlet,然后调用对应的servlet,该servlet调用其他层并进行处理,最后将结果响应给用户。在用户进行第一次访问时创建的servlet会进行加载、初始化、第一次服务,在用户结束服务之前这个servlet一直存在。在用户结束服务时,该servlet会进行销毁函数,然后gc会对该servlet进行卸载。所以

2020-10-06 10:26:42 68

原创 伪列的创建

伪列的创建伪列是什么?伪列是一种用来标识查询结果的一列序号。(有时自增主键列并不是连续的,或者查询结果中自增主键列是截断的,这时就要用到伪列)如图:但MySQL中并没有伪列的关键字,所以要创建伪列就要自己手动创建。创建伪列代码:SELECT @rownum:=@rownum+1 AS row_num, s.* FROM (SELECT @rownum:=0)r, student AS s;@与@@​ @是定义的用户变量,@@定义的是系统变量。例如:set @a = 10

2020-10-04 18:55:02 263

ssmbuild.zip

一个springmvc的脚手架,通用基础配置。

2021-03-01

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除